Interpolation of -compactness and Pcf

We call a topological space κ-compact if every subset of size κ has a complete accumulation point in it. Let Φ(μ, κ, λ) denote the following statement: μ < κ < λ = cf(λ) and there is {Sξ : ξ < λ} ⊂ [κ] μ such that |{ξ : |Sξ ∩ A| = μ}| < λ whenever A ∈ [κ]. We show that if Φ(μ, κ, λ) holds and the space X is both μ-compact and λ-compact then X is κ-compact as well. Moreover, from PCF theory we deduce Φ(cf(κ), κ, κ) for every singular cardinal κ. As a corollary we get that a linearly Lindelöf and אω-compact space is uncountably compact, that is κ-compact for all uncountable cardinals κ.

PCF self-similar sets and fractal interpolation
The aim of this paper is to show, using some of Barnsley’s ideas, how it is possible to generalize a fractal interpolation problem to certain post critically finite (PCF) compact sets in R. متن کاملCompactness and Incompactness Phenomena in Set Theory
We prove two results with a common theme: the tension between compactness and incompactness phenomena in combinatorial set theory. Theorem 1 uses PCF theory to prove a sort of “compactness” for a version of Dzamonja and Shelah’s strong non-reflection principle. متن کاملCompactness properties for trace-class operators and applications to quantum mechanics
Interpolation inequalities of Gagliardo-Nirenberg type and compactness results for self-adjoint trace-class operators with finite kinetic energy are established. Applying these results to the minimization of various free energy functionals, we determine for instance stationary states of the Hartree problem with temperature corresponding to various statistics.
